As soon as we checked in we literally dropped off our luggage and headed straight for the convention center.  Tonight was that all-important crazy event known as “Sample Spree.”  In a nutshell, it’s an opportunity for us to purchase selected product before it’s released for sale to the general public.  The doors open at 8 p.m., but the professional spree’rs (is that a word?) start lining up well before six.  When we got there it looked like this:

We have just received nine bolts of the most gorgeous wovens I’ve ever seen.  They are from the Spring Magic collection by April Cornell for Moda.  In lush bubblegum colors of Pink, Aqua, Yellow, Lime, a dash of Melon and White, these fabrics are accented with the shimmer of silver metallic thread (lurex).  What a perfect enhancement to any quilt, sewing or crafting project, both spring and summer.
